Tuberama
 

Wessex Tubas has just returned from a fantastic weekend exhibiting at the Yorkshire Regional Championships at Bradford’s St George’s Hall.

Wonderful weekend

And it proved to be a wonderful weekend both on and off the contest stage for Wessex Tubas too, with Second Section winners Cornerstone Brass claiming victory by using both a Wessex EEb bass and tenor horn.

During the weekend, Wessex Tubas showed its commitment to the banding world by agreeing to sponsor 'Tubarama', the exciting world record challenge to be held on 30th June at the famous York Racecourse.

World record

It is hoped that over 550 tuba performers will take part to create a new world record, so Wessex is asking all tuba and euphonium players to put the date in their diaries and get over to York.

Wessex has kindly donated one of their ground breaking Bubbie Eb mini tubas to 'Tubarama' to be given in prize draw of all participants.

Go to http://doublebtyke.wix.com/tubarama to register for attendance.

Scotland

This coming weekend, Wessex Tubas will be exhibiting at the Scottish Championships in Perth to give players north of the border a taste of some of the best value for money instruments you can buy!
